n Microsoft 365 Copilot Cowork (Frontier), a custom remote MCP server connector declared via agentConnectors → toolSource.remoteMcpServer:
- Works perfectly when authorization.type = "None".
- With authorization.type = "OAuthPluginVault" (Entra OAuth), the connector connects and completes the OAuth consent successfully, skills load, but every tool invocation from chat fails ("…the connector isn't responding in this session"). The server never receives an authenticated tool call.
The same MCP server and the same OAuth client registration work end-to-end with full per-user OAuth in a declarative agent in Microsoft 365 Copilot chat (m365.cloud.microsoft/chat). Only Cowork's OAuthPluginVault path fails.
This looks like Cowork is not carrying the connector's OAuth token into chat-time tool calls.
Environment
- Microsoft 365 Copilot Cowork (Frontier preview), plugin sideloaded via M365 Admin Center → Manage Apps.
- App package: M365 unified manifest v1.28, contains agentSkills + one agentConnectors entry.
- MCP server: .NET 8, official ModelContextProtocol / ModelContextProtocol.AspNetCore SDK, Streamable HTTP transport, public HTTPS (TLS 1.2+), behind nginx at https://<your-domain>/mcp/.
- Auth: Microsoft Entra ID. Single app registration, multi-tenant; OAuth client registration created in Teams Developer Portal with usage = "Any Microsoft 365 Organization"; exposes scope api://<app-id>/access_as_user; requestedAccessTokenVersion = 2. Redirect URIs include https://teams.microsoft.com/api/platform/v1.0/oAuthRedirect and https://teams.microsoft.com/api/platform/v1.0/oAuthConsentRedirect.
Connector manifest (sanitized)
"agentConnectors": [
{
"id": "cts-cowork-server",
"displayName": "CTS Inbox Agent",
"description": "Entra-secured MCP server",
"toolSource": {
"remoteMcpServer": {
"mcpServerUrl": "https://<your-domain>/mcp/",
"authorization": {
"type": "OAuthPluginVault",
"referenceId": "<oauth-client-registration-id>"
}
}
}
}
]
(Tools are discovered dynamically; behavior is identical with or without a static mcpToolDescription.)
What works ✅
- authorization.type = "None" on the exact same connector/server → Cowork connects, discovers tools, and invokes them correctly in chat. So the transport, dynamic discovery (initialize / tools/list / tools/call, Streamable HTTP), and tool schemas are all compatible with Cowork.
- The same OAuth client registration (referenceId) and the same MCP server, used by a declarative agent in M365 Copilot chat, work end-to-end: the OAuth consent succeeds and tool calls arrive at the server bearing a valid Entra v2 access token (aud = the API app, azp = the client app, scp = access_as_user, correct issuer). The server validates it and returns live data.
What fails ❌
With authorization.type = "OAuthPluginVault" in Cowork:
- In Sources & Skills, the connector appears and "Connect" / sign-in completes successfully (Entra consent succeeds — no AADSTS error).
- Skills load in chat.
- When the user asks something that triggers a connector tool, Cowork responds with a message like "I'm unable to reach the connector — it isn't responding in this session."
- Server-side during the failure: the connect/validation phase reaches the server, but chat-time tool invocations do not arrive at the server as authenticated calls. (The server logs every request, including unauthenticated ones, which it correctly rejects with 401 while EnforceAuth = true. During the chat-time failure, no valid authenticated tool call is received.)
What I've ruled out
- MCP transport / discovery — Cowork's own docs state it uses Streamable HTTP with dynamic discovery; my server supports initialize / tools/list / tools/call, and a Microsoft Copilot client (the declarative agent) completes full sessions against it.
- Tool schema completeness — tools expose full JSON inputSchema; the None-auth connector invokes them fine.
- The OAuth registration itself — it mints valid per-user v2 tokens that my server accepts; verified by the declarative agent working with the identical referenceId.
- Redirect URIs / consent — the OAuth/consent step in Cowork succeeds; there is no AADSTS failure in Entra sign-in logs at connect time.
- Server availability / auth enforcement — server is up; anonymous requests are correctly 401 with EnforceAuth = true; the None-auth path only works when enforcement is disabled.
Conclusion / the question
Everything points to a Cowork-side issue in the OAuthPluginVault flow: the connector authenticates at connect time, but the acquired token is not bound to / sent on chat-time MCP tool calls, so the server never receives an authenticated request and the tool call fails.
- Is this a known limitation/bug in the current Cowork (Frontier) preview for third-party remote MCP connectors using OAuthPluginVault?
- Is there any additional manifest, registration, or scope configuration required for Cowork specifically (vs. a declarative agent) to carry the user token into tool calls?
- If it's a known preview gap, is there an ETA or a supported interim pattern for per-user authenticated custom MCP connectors in Cowork (i.e., something other than None, which is anonymous and unacceptable for production data)?


Minimal repro
- Stand up a remote MCP server (Streamable HTTP) that requires an Entra bearer token.
- Register an OAuth client (TDP, "Any Microsoft 365 Organization") for it.
- Package a Cowork plugin with one agentConnectors → remoteMcpServer using OAuthPluginVault + that referenceId. Sideload.
- Connect the connector in Sources & Skills (consent succeeds), then ask chat to use a tool → fails; server receives no authenticated tool call.
- Switch the same connector to authorization.type = "None" (and allow anonymous on the server) → works. Use the same referenceId in a declarative agent in M365 Copilot chat → works.
